Birmingham Weekend Highlights: A Busy Lineup Awaits

This weekend in Birmingham promises a variety of events and activities for residents and visitors alike. From job fairs and live music to community celebrations, there is certainly something for everyone to enjoy. Here’s a rundown of the weekend happenings.

Max Transit Job Fair

On both Friday and Saturday, the Max Transit Job Fair will take place from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. at 1801 Morris Avenue in downtown Birmingham. This event is an excellent opportunity for those seeking a career in public transportation. Available positions include bus operators, skilled mechanics, and maintenance staff, all offering competitive pay and benefits. Anyone interested is encouraged to attend and explore the job openings.

Live Music and Entertainment

For those looking to enjoy some local talent, The Nick will host several music acts throughout the weekend. On Friday, catch The Weeping Willows and Lachlan Bryan for a night filled with folk and acoustic sounds. At the same venue on Saturday, Jon Spencer will perform alongside The Sueves, while Burlesque Night will be hosted by Bella Donna. The combination of music and entertainment at The Nick ensures a vibrant atmosphere for fans.

If you prefer to venture to the brewery scene, True Story Brewing will hold several events, including Karaoke with Joseph on Tuesday and the ever-popular Blues Jam on the third Thursday of each month.

Community Gatherings

This Sunday, join fellow residents at the Railroad Park for a community picnic to celebrate Birmingham. The picnic will feature live music, food, and a variety of family-friendly activities. It’s a great way to enjoy a relaxing day outdoors while connecting with neighbors.

Cultural Events and Festivals

Birmingham’s cultural calendar is bustling this weekend, starting with the Rhythms of Color Art Festival on Saturday at the Harbert Center. This festival will showcase student art and encourage participation from local artists. Don’t miss out on the chance to appreciate the creativity and talent within our community.

Continuing the cultural theme, the Magic City Mac + Cheese Festival will take place on October 20 at Back Forty Beer Company, where attendees can enjoy a day full of cheesy delights and family fun.

Expectations for Upcoming Events

Looking ahead, mark your calendars for the 6th Annual Lula K. Jordan BBQ Cook-off Competition on October 12. This event is set to be a culinary highlight for BBQ lovers in the community. Additionally, the Alabama Farmers Market Fall Festival on October 5 will offer a fantastic selection of local produce, crafts, and family-friendly activities.

Cinema Offerings

Film enthusiasts can catch a screening of The Godfather Part II today or head over to the Sidewalk Film Center for the weekend lineup, which includes family favorites like The Sound of Music and new releases featuring big-name stars.
